你查询的IP:[121.4.162.37]  地理位置:中国–上海–上海

最新查询119.3.168.68 124.112.7.50 118.80.77.98 120.32.49.48 121.4.60.241 59.107.80.26 124.47.21.41 117.8.56.175 117.60.86.59 121.4.162.37 119.253.217.143 220.242.178.184 117.103.128.20 203.91.120.174 58.144.25.184 218.104.170.112 124.248.22.98 202.150.16.56 210.28.27.133 161.207.67.44 202.38.146.51 119.2.121.48 221.176.10.134 162.105.135.43 123.64.55.223 202.164.25.63 219.72.243.249 203.208.16.69 119.18.192.78 202.127.40.154 203.212.80.196